How No Deposit Bonuses Actually Work in the USA

When you register at a casino like BetMGM or Borgata Online, you might see a promo for "$20 Free" or "50 Free Spins" with no deposit required. This isn't a gift; it's a marketing tool. The casino credits your account with bonus funds. You can use these to play eligible games, but you cannot withdraw the bonus itself. You can only withdraw the winnings you generate from it, and only after meeting the playthrough requirements. For example, a "$10 No Deposit Bonus with a 30x wager" means you must bet $300 ($10 x 30) before any winnings become cash you can withdraw.

The Critical Fine Print: Wagering and Game Restrictions

This is where most players get tripped up. The wagering requirement (or playthrough) is the multiplier you must meet. A 30x requirement is standard; anything over 40x is steep. Also, not all games contribute 100% to the requirement. Slots usually count fully, but table games like blackjack or video poker might only contribute 10% or be excluded entirely. Always check the "Bonus Terms" or "Promotional Terms" link before you claim.

Why do casinos offer free money with no deposit?

It's a powerful customer acquisition tool. They spend $20 to get you to try their platform, hoping you'll enjoy the experience and become a depositing player. The vast majority of players who claim a no deposit bonus will either not win or fail to meet the wagering, so it's a calculated cost for the casino.

What's the difference between no deposit and free play?

They are often used interchangeably, but "free play" can sometimes refer to a bonus where you get to play with house money but cannot keep any winnings—it's just for fun. A true "no deposit real money" bonus means the winnings, after meeting terms, are yours to keep and cash out.
